The EU network EUReKKa invites you to a webinar on Thursday, November 27: The key to successful research collaboration – together on climate adaptation and preparedness!
The webinar will focus on how you can successfully build strong collaborations between research actors and the municipal sector , with particular emphasis on the opportunities in Horizon Europe. At the same time, the discussion will have great transfer value to national calls and other fields of study – because the topic of “how to succeed in cross-sector research collaboration” is relevant to many.
We use climate adaptation and preparedness as a starting point, but the experiences and advice will be useful for anyone who wants to build strong partnerships between research and the municipality, regardless of field.
The purpose is to:
- Get to know each other’s organizations better and lower the threshold for collaboration between the municipal sector and research environments
- Provide better insight into how we can establish and further develop good collaborative projects together
- Provide practical tips for networking and partner hunting
- Have a discussion about pitfalls and success factors in EU projects – with transfer value to national initiatives
- Make visible examples of roles and opportunities for municipalities and county authorities in research projects
- Provide opportunities to ask questions and actively participate in the dialogue
